Optimizing Efficiency: Top Strategies for Contemporary Fleet Administration

In today's dynamic and competitive landscape, effective fleet management is crucial for success. To optimize operational efficiency and minimize costs, fleets must embrace innovative technologies and implement best practices. A well-structured system for managing vehicles, drivers, and maintenance can significantly impact a company's bottom line.

  • Employing real-time tracking systems to monitor vehicle location, fuel consumption, and driver behavior provides valuable data that can be used to improve route planning, reduce idling time, and promote safer driving practices.
  • Implementing a comprehensive maintenance schedule ensures vehicles are kept in peak condition, minimizing downtime and repair costs. Regular inspections and preventative maintenance can increase the lifespan of vehicles.
  • Investing in driver training programs can enhance their skills, improve safety, and promote fuel-efficient driving habits. Well-trained drivers are less likely to be involved in accidents and contribute to a greater level of operational efficiency.

Additionally, automation can play a vital role in streamlining many fleet management tasks, such as scheduling maintenance, managing driver logs, and processing invoices. By implementing these technologies, businesses can redirect valuable resources to focus on other core functions.

Techniques for Fuel Cost Reduction in Sustainable Fleets

Sustainable fleet management requires a meticulous approach to decrease fuel consumption and operational costs. Implementing smart approaches can significantly impact your bottom line while minimizing your environmental footprint.

One effective method is implementing advanced driver training programs that focus on sustainable driving practices. This empowers drivers to maximize fuel efficiency through smooth acceleration, consistent speeds, and anticipatory braking.

Additionally, regular vehicle maintenance is crucial for peak performance and fuel economy. Ensuring proper tire pressure, air filter cleanliness, and engine tune-ups can substantially reduce fuel consumption.

Leveraging telematics technology allows for real-time monitoring of fuel usage patterns. This offers valuable insights into driver behavior and vehicle performance, enabling specific interventions to optimize fuel efficiency.

Explore alternative fuels like biofuels or compressed natural gas (CNG) as a viable option for your fleet. These cleaner-burning alternatives can reduce greenhouse gas emissions while potentially saving fuel costs in the long run.
